Job Description
Salary: $37-$38

Summary Description:


Assist agency RN/Healthcare Supervisor  (HCS) in overseeing health and safety supports for all individuals with a focus on individuals in our Residential Program. Assist in completing all necessary medical documentation, developing residential policies and procedures, trainings for program staff, and hospital discharges. Support residential managers with clinical questions both in person and via the phone.


The LPN would work 3 days a week in the day program and would focus on the care of participants who are also in our residential program. These 3 days the hours would be 8:30 - 3:30. The other 2 days would be from 9:30-5:30 with the expectation being that they would be at the residences from 3-5:30pm on those days. There is some flexibility on the two late days, but not a Monday or a Friday.


Requirements:          


Graduate of an accredited LPN program. Current Massachusetts license as a Licensed Practical Nurse in good standing. Ability to lift and support body weight of any program individual with assistance of another employee. Professional appearance and demeanor.  Possession of a valid Driver’s license, a clean driving record and a willingness to use agency vehicle in the course of employment.
